The trial of former Venezuelan President Nicolas Maduro on drug-related charges will begin on June 1, 2027, in New York. The date was announced following a preliminary hearing at the federal court in Manhattan on Wednesday. Maduro, 63, was arrested in Caracas on January 3 by U.S. authorities and transferred to a Brooklyn detention facility. He faces four counts of indictment, including narcotics terrorism. His wife, Cilia Flores, 69, is charged with three counts. Both have denied the allegations against them. In a letter sent by public prosecutor Jay Clayton to Judge Alvin Hellerstein on Tuesday, both parties requested that the trial start in June 2027. However, the scheduling change occurred after the U.S. government approved Venezuela’s request to cover legal costs for the accused, which had initially been blocked by the administration citing international sanctions imposed on the country. This decision marks a shift in policy, allowing the accused to bear some financial burden of their defense. Maduro first appeared before the court shortly after his arrest during a military operation involving approximately 150 aircraft and helicopters. During this appearance, he described himself as a “prisoner of war.” The criminal proceedings against the former president are ongoing, while the families of five young men killed in Venezuela have filed a separate lawsuit against him in early July, accusing him of ordering their deaths as part of broader state violence. Since Maduro's ousting, interim president Delcy Rodriguez has taken control of the country under pressure from Washington, which claims to have influence over Venezuela’s oil-rich resources.
